Understanding what a code reader can and cannot do for your car is crucial, especially when dealing with modern vehicle diagnostics. Code readers, also known as OBD2 scanners, are essential tools for car owners and mechanics alike. They primarily function to retrieve diagnostic trouble codes (DTCs) from your vehicle’s computer system, offering a starting point for identifying potential issues.
These devices, readily available to the public, can access your car’s powertrain control module (PCM) and extract P-codes, which relate to engine and transmission problems. For instance, a generic code reader can accurately report a misfire in cylinder 4, indicated by a specific code. It’s important to note that while a generic reader will give you the correct code number (like P1234), the descriptive explanation it provides might not always be accurate for every car brand. For example, P1234 in a general reader is still P1234 for a Saab, but the interpretation and troubleshooting steps specific to Saab vehicles are essential.
However, it’s a misconception to think that code readers “program” your car in the sense of re-flashing or modifying the engine control unit (ECU) software for performance tuning or feature changes. Instead, their primary function is diagnostic. They highlight problem areas by presenting codes, but they do not pinpoint the root cause. In the misfire example, the code reader tells you that there’s a misfire, but not why. The “why” could stem from various factors, including faulty spark plugs, fuel injectors, or vacuum leaks.
For in-depth diagnosis, especially with brands like Saab, relying solely on a generic code reader is insufficient. Resources like the Workshop Information System (WIS) are invaluable. WIS provides detailed technical descriptions of each code and outlines specific troubleshooting procedures recommended by the manufacturer. If you’re consulting a mechanic unfamiliar with Saab vehicles, directing them to WIS is highly advisable. Without such specific guidance, mechanics may resort to guesswork and start replacing parts hoping to solve the problem – a costly process known as “parts-swapping.” This approach is not only expensive but can also lead to the installation of inferior aftermarket components, especially for critical parts like crank position sensors or ignition coils. Ironically, the original equipment manufacturer (OEM) part might have been perfectly fine, and the issue could lie elsewhere.
In conclusion, code readers are powerful diagnostic tools for accessing your car’s error codes, offering a vital first step in identifying potential problems. They do not program your car’s core functions but rather provide information about existing faults. For accurate diagnosis and effective repairs, especially for specialized brands, combining code reader information with manufacturer-specific resources and expert knowledge is essential to avoid unnecessary costs and ensure the use of quality parts.